Initiative Musik Opens Applications for New Funding Round

Germany’s Initiative Musik has announced the third edition of its Live 500 funding programme, offering almost €1 million in grants to support small and medium-sized venues and regional event organisers.

Applications will be accepted from 15–29 September 2025. Grants of €500 per event are available for up to 20 concerts or club nights, with audience limits of 250 for live shows and 500 for predominantly DJ-led events. The maximum funding per applicant is €10,000.

The scheme aims to distribute support evenly between urban and rural regions, with a 50% diversity quota. Organisers who benefited from the first two editions will not be eligible, a restriction introduced due to high demand.

Three online information sessions will be held on 20 August, 2 September, and 10 September to guide applicants through the process.

Launched in 2023 with a budget of €2.7 million, Live 500 allocated just under €900,000 in its second round. The programme is funded by the Federal Government Commissioner for Culture and the Media.
